I think it would be a good idea to allow transparency in the viewport as an option for the material. This would help people creat things from reference images so they can see the background while modeling, and be able to tell how the faces ar oriented because of shading(can't happen in wireframe)

i may be interpreting what you guys are wanting incorrectly...
but try to turn OFF the little icon with the shaded box in the 3d view header in edit mode
(its only visible when you're in shaded mode)
its next to the selection mode buttons
you may be pleasantly surprised
